Rules, information and Q&A for the DH series:

Q1: I am new to your events. What is some general information that can help before I show up. A1: Helmets are mandatory. It is highly recommended to have body protection too. Make sure you are on time for your shuttle and start time. You will receive a wristband at pre-registration. Any racer without a wristband will not be allowed on the course and will not get timed or scored.
Q2: Will there be any practice days before the events? A2: ASRA Mammoth Bar OHV area is open year round, depending on weather conditions. There will be NO practice on race day.
Q3: Will there be RV or trailer camping? A3: There is no over night camping in the OHV area. Day use only.
Q4: Does the California State Park charge an entrance fee? A4: Yes. $10.00. Try to call pool to save a few bones.
Q5: Do we need a race license? A5: No
Q6: Will the course be marked a few days before the event? A6: Yes. Both courses will have arrows and chalk.
Q7: Is this a point series? And if so, how will points be awarded? A7: Racers will get the most points for their best finishes. 1st place 100 points, 2nd place 95, etc. See chart below.
